Frequently Asked Questions about Miami Beach

What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in Miami Beach, FL?

As of today, August 09, 2026, there are currently 2,828 available Miami Beach apartments priced from $1,000 to $38,596, with an average monthly rent of $3,493.

What Miami Beach neighborhoods have the most available apartments?

There are 33 neighborhoods in the Miami Beach area with available listings as of today. The three neighborhoods with the most options are Downtown Miami with 4,303 listings, Park West with 2,443 listings, and Riverside Community with 1,825 listings.

How much are Studio apartments in Miami Beach?

There are currently 1,234 Studio Apartments in Miami Beach with rent ranges from $1,000 to $10,353 with an average price of $2,578.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Miami Beach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Miami Beach ranges from $1,500 to $13,621 with an average monthly rent of $3,138.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Miami Beach c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Miami Beach range from $1,820 to $30,399.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,292.

How expensive are Miami Beach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 265 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Miami Beach on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,300 to $30,000 - averaging $6,990 for the location.
